6 to 8 weeks tho is defintly possible.
I would ask how many orders ahead of you, and how many they(dealership) are allocated each month. Also get a cop of the DORA if you do order. check on priority #, this can give you somewhat of an idea

Yep your wait time heavily depends on dealer you go through (allocation size) and how many orders are in front of you (priority number)

Make sure you find out both if you want to have a real idea of how long it will take!
